The following Scriptures are the inspired words of God:



I Timothy 2:11: A woman should learn in quietness and full submission. I do not permit a woman to teach or to have authority over a man, she must be silent.



I Cor 14:33-35: "In *ALL* the congregations of the saints, women should remain silent in the churches. They are not allowed to speak, but must be in submission, as the Law says. If they want to inquire about something, they should ask their own husbands at home; for it is disgraceful for a woman to speak in the church.



However women may witness to men outside of the church as per Acts 18:26: When Priscilla and Aquila heard **him**, they invited *him* to their home and {THEY-plural} explained to him the way of God more adequately."



Since boys do do become "men" in God's Word until they are 12 years old I believe a woman can teach boys 11 years and under in Sunday School.



Women may also teach other women of all ages in Sunday School or in women's only services with boys under 12 present. {See Titus 2:3-5}



I would not consider this Open Forum for all beliefs; to be a "CHURCH"; and since there are women in this forum it is certainly permissable for women to teach God's Word here to other women. If a man doesn't believe a women can teach on this forum since there are men here then he doesn't have to read the women's posts.



Women may not be overseers, deacons or elders as per I Timothy 3:2,8 & Titus 1:6



Read Proverbs 31:10-31 and I Peter 3:1-6.
